#055737 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#055737 is composed of 2% red, 34.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 156.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 18%. #055737 color hex could be obtained by blending #0aae6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#055737 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#055737 has RGB values of R:5, G:87,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 350007.

Shades and Tints of #055737
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d08 is the darkest color, while #f9f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#055737
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c302e is the less saturated color, while #015b38 is the most saturated one.
